As Alex has said he has experienced a similar issue. There are 2 issues going on here. The majority of the time they can be fixed by changing the Exadsi loggin to the domain account, unfortunately this did not work in for Alex, but I would like to try it for you.
depending on the SQL version you are running you will find the Exadsi
in MSSQL 2005 you can find it here
Run MS SQL Server Management Studio
Open the tree view to your SQL Server
Open "Server Objects", "Linked Servers", "Providers"
In MSSQL 2000
Run MSSQL enterprise manager
In Security, Linked Servers Exadsi.
For both, please change the remote login to the admin account.
